What’s the real difference between Reformer Pilates and standard Pilates?

Regular Pilates is finished within the mat. It focuses on core energy, breathwork, alignment and sluggish, managed movement. Reformer Pilates uses a machine with springs, straps along with a sliding carriage to amplify or soften the intensity. Visualize it like the distinction between swimming laps and employing a kickboard — similar ideas, distinctive gears.

Does Reformer Pilates basically give an even better training?

“Much better” depends on what Your whole body demands — but the machine does change the sport.

Reformer Pilates can:

Raise resistance with adjustable springs

Concentrate on little stabilising muscles you didn’t know existed

Make improvements to choice of movement via supported stretching

Give extra progression options for rehab or energy instruction

Mat Pilates can:

Make deep Main endurance without the need of external help

Boost mobility by way of managed, minimal-effect sequences

Be finished anyplace — no products, no excuses

Is Reformer Pilates more challenging than regular Pilates?

Frequently, Indeed — although not for The explanations people today expect.

The load doesn’t originate from “lifting heavier”. It comes from:

The springs adding resistance

The carriage shifting underneath you

The instability forcing further muscle recruitment

What’s superior for harm rehab: Reformer or mat?

Most physios in Australia lean toward Reformer for early rehab mainly because it features controlled help. You'll be able to minimize load, isolate muscles and Construct mobility without having aggravating accidents.

Mat Pilates is fantastic for later levels of rehab, where you rebuild endurance, coordination and purposeful energy.
